Freaky geeks, rejoice! You can now broadcast your sex from your specs.
Thanks to sophisticated advances in tech-XXX-nology, OnlyFans models — with bad vision or just an affinity for artificially-intelligent accessories — will soon be able to livestream their steamiest content with a $299 pair of AI-powered eyewear.
“Mentra Live is the only smart glasses with an app store, so your experience constantly evolves,” the website reads. “Ask AI questions about what you see, capture photos and videos, livestream to anywhere (Twitch, X, YouTube, TikTok, OnlyFans), listen to music, take calls, get live captions and translations, take notes and much more.”

OnlyFans models and streaming content creators will soon be able to reach their audiences hands-free with Mentra Live smart glasses. M-Production – stock.adobe.com
So, yes, they boast an array of features beyond the ability to shoot and share porn in real-time. Still, that’s arguably one of the coolest, kinkiest perks of owning a pair.
The wearable tech space — slated to hit the market February 15, and will only be made available in the US — will join the likes of behemoth brand Ray-Ban Meta, with smart glasses from $299 to $799.
